This crowd-pleasing, bargain-priced, méthode champenoise aka Cap Classique has a bright salmon pink colour. Gently spicy, slightly toasty, fairly complex, ripe plum-raspberry fruit on the nose. Dry, medium bodied, well structured, slightly spicy, bright, ripe, plum-cherry-raspberry purée flavours with a lingering, fairly effervescent, mouth filling, harmonious finish. Impressive and ready to drink. Based on the 2019 vintage, it is a NEW blend of 51% Chardonnay, 44% Pinot Noir, 3% Pinot Meunier, 1% Pinot Gris and 1% Chenin Blanc. It has 12.2% alcohol, 6.8 g/L residual sugar and 6 g/L total acidity with lot number 19G21/19/25/1-LJ130H21 on the back label. This code means 19-19th day; G-July; 21-2021 (degorgement on July 19, 2021) then /19-2019 vintage and /25-25 months on lees.Tasted on March 30, 2022 from a bottle purchased at the LCBO. |
